Vishal Dogra Biography

I have started writing poems in 2004 with 'infatuation'. The poem Lord Mother is my second poem. It is about Goddess. I was appointed in present service because of its recitation for the interview body. Its miracle, I can never forget. Miracles do happen for me as and when I write for my Deity Goddess. I believe in God. My favourite collection of poem is Gitanjali of Shri Ravindranath Tagore. My favourite film is 'Modern Times' of Charlie Chapline)

The Best Poem Of Vishal Dogra

Their Brood

I am groping in the dark a light of truth;
The light which can shimmer the future of brood

Round the world kids live naked; not by choice but by fate
Striving for food, poor are many
Faint, dull faces struggle for a penny,
Harder they moil, sweating through toil
Lay on earth having food, cloth dearth
Let’s jump into crimes - songs ever chime
Notice them, save them to pierce dark through
The light which can shimmer the future of brood.

Alas! Sand lies on seashore
have plenty of water but throats get sore
Tides come through their heart
Settle through eyes with tears dearth
They imagine in dreams for their brood
Grouping in the dark a light of truth
